When pitching the ball, you need to learn how to properly hold and throw the ball. You start by placing your middle finger right on the seam. Next, put your thumb on top of the other seam. This helps you get the best grip on the ball for throwing it effectively.

If you are a baseball coach, you need a great practice schedule. Having one means players can be prepared for what is to come. An effective 30 minute practice incorporates a short warm-up with a lengthier period of hitting drills. Once that is completed you can expect running and other team drills. Complete the practice with a ten minutes of position-specific defensive drills and a cooling down period. Once practice is finished, meet with the team then go home.

To prevent a bunt from returning to the pitcher, point your bat handle towards third base, or aim its head to first if you hit right. If you are using your left hand mostly, reverse the bases. Pointing the bat properly makes sure the bunt stays fair and away from the mound.

Choke up on your bat if you are looking to speed up your swing. This means that you should grasp the bat at a point that is a little closer to the barrel. Also, you will get to the ball faster. It could give you an advantage if a pitcher is particularly fast.
